Tips to Reduce Your Dental Bills

1. Schedule regular checkups and cleanings: Prevention is key when it comes to dental care. By staying on top of your oral health, you can avoid more expensive dental problems down the road. Be sure to schedule regular checkups and teeth cleanings with your dentist.

2. Know your insurance coverage: Dental insurance can be confusing. Make sure you know what your plan covers before you have any work done. This way, you can be prepared for any out-of-pocket costs.

3. Consider alternatives to traditional dental care: There are a number of alternative options for dental care that can save you money. For example, dental schools often offer low-cost services, and there are a number of discount dental plans available.

4. Don’t wait to address dental problems: If you have a dental problem, don’t wait to get it treated. The longer you wait, the more expensive it will be to fix the problem. So if you have a toothache or other issue, be sure to see your dentist right away.

Dentists’ Recommendations for Reducing Dental Costs

No one likes getting a big bill from the dentist. But there are some simple things you can do to help reduce the cost of dental care. Here are some tips from dentists themselves:

1. Brush and floss regularly. This may seem like an obvious one, but it’s worth repeating. Proper oral hygiene is the best way to prevent costly dental problems down the road.

2. See your dentist for regular checkups and cleanings. Again, this may seem like common sense, but many people skip out on routine dental visits. By seeing your dentist regularly, you can catch problems early and avoid more serious (and expensive) treatment later on.

3. When choosing a dental plan, make sure it covers preventive care. Many insurance plans now cover 100% of the cost of preventive care, so there’s no excuse not to take advantage of it. Regular cleanings and checkups can save you a lot of money in the long run.

4. Don’t wait until you have a problem to see a dentist. If you’re experiencing pain or other dental problems, don’t wait to see a dentist. The sooner you get treatment, the less expensive it will be.
